Matthew Reilly wrote:
> Thanks a lot, I'll check it out. Thanks also to the people who responded
> to the other half of my question. I have the 1.3 release, I guess that's
> what's causing my problems.

If you have the 1.3 release, you should probably get 1.3 kernel source (or
1.3.1 and upgrade your binaries as well).  Both are available beneath
the appropriate release hierarchy on ftp.netbsd.org and its mirrors.  If
you're going to compile a -current kernel, you might want to do a binary
upgrade to -current first.
